AbstractWe focus on epidemics response supply chains and use system dynamics to model the impact of the logistics distribution structure on programs efficiency and effectiveness. We derive valuable insights for humanitarian operation managers. We use real data from the Ebola response to validate our model.

Biography
Laura Turrini is a Junior Professor of Operations Management at EBS Business School. Professor Turrini completed her doctoral studies in the field of Logistics at Kühne Logistics University. In 2009 she graduated in Mathematics in Milan (Italy), with a master thesis regarding voting systems and PageRank, the Google ranking algorithm. She won and held the INdAM (National Institute for High Mathematics, Italy) scholarship for the whole master period. After graduation she gained two years of industry experience, first as IT consultant and from June 2010 to September 2011 as Revenue Management Support in an Italian all cargo airline.
